The Dung Economy, Revisited
Using animal excrement as a building component is ancient practice. Across millennia, humans have mixed cattle dung with clay and straw to form cob, stabilized earthen walls, and even insulated roofs. What changes over time is not the material itself but the cultural lens through which we view it. In Phang Nga province, southern Thailand, architect Boonserm Premthada has completed Goya, a tower constructed from bricks made entirely of elephant waste. The project treats dung not as a byproduct to be managed, but as a resource with tectonic and symbolic potential.
Each brick is handmade and sun-baked, measuring 33 centimeters in diameter and 5 centimeters thick. The composition is straightforward: grass, leaves, fruit remnants, and fibrous plant matter that elephants consume and expel. The resulting material is structurally adequate for low-load applications and carries minimal embodied energy, requiring no kiln firing. It took a full year to produce the bricks and assemble the tower, a timeline that reflects both the labor intensity of the process and the seasonal rhythms of elephant digestion.
Formal Language and Assembly
Goya reads as a cluster of cylindrical columns rising to varying heights, their silhouettes staggered across the site. The bricks are threaded onto central steel rods, a technique that recalls modular construction systems but with a distinctly organic material palette. Five pigmented variations create a banded, gradient effect along each column, a chromatic gesture that Premthada describes as inspired by layered ice lollies. The palette ranges from pale ochre to deep terracotta, echoing the tones of laterite and fired clay common in Southeast Asian vernacular building.
Visitors enter at grade and ascend a curved staircase that weaves between the towers. The spatial experience is intimate, with fenestration limited to the gaps between columns. Views open intermittently toward the surrounding landscape, a forested expanse punctuated by limestone karst formations. The massing is neither monumental nor minimal; it occupies a middle register, legible as architecture but retaining the handmade irregularities of its constituent parts.
Material as Cultural Index
Elephant dung has been repurposed for centuries in Thailand and neighboring regions. It is pulped for paper, composted for fertilizer, and even processed into insect repellent. One niche application involves coffee: undigested beans retrieved from elephant waste are fermented and roasted to produce Black Ivory Coffee, marketed as one of the world's rarest brews. Premthada's use of the material extends this tradition into the built environment, reframing waste as a medium for spatial production.
The choice is also legible within the architect's broader practice. His Elephant World project, completed in 2020, received the Best Sanctuary award at the Wallpaper* Design Awards. That project explored spatial typologies for elephant care and human interaction, employing rammed earth and bamboo. Goya continues this line of inquiry, but shifts focus from enclosure to monument, from shelter to marker.
Site and Myth
Phang Nga province lies in southern Thailand, a region where human settlement and elephant habitats have overlapped for centuries. The animals shaped forest clearings, trails, and water access points; in turn, human communities developed economic and ceremonial relationships with them. Today, elephants remain central to regional identity, even as habitat loss and tourism pressure complicate their presence.
At the heart of Phang Nga is Khao Chang, or Elephant Mountain, a limestone massif whose profile resembles a reclining elephant. Local legend holds that a male elephant fell there and turned to stone, a narrative that blends geology with myth. Goya is named after a female elephant born in the area, a gesture that ties the structure to both legend and living memory.
The tower stands at the entrance to Matalay, a resort development. Its function is primarily symbolic: a gateway object that signals the site's engagement with local ecology and heritage. It does not house program in the conventional sense. Instead, it operates as a promenade and viewpoint, a structure whose primary purpose is experiential rather than utilitarian.
Precedents and Parallels
Goya invites comparison with other projects that employ unconventional organic materials. Anna Heringer's METI School in Bangladesh, built with cob and bamboo, demonstrated that low-tech materials could achieve formal sophistication and climatic performance. Francis Kéré's work in Burkina Faso has long utilized compressed earth and laterite, materials abundant in their contexts and requiring minimal processing. In Thailand itself, the Earth Architecture program at Chiang Mai University has documented vernacular techniques using rice husk ash, bamboo, and stabilized earth.
What distinguishes Goya is its unapologetic embrace of a material often dismissed as abject. Dung carries cultural baggage; it is waste, associated with hygiene concerns and low status. By elevating it to the scale of architecture, Premthada forces a reconsideration of material hierarchies. The project does not hide its composition. The bricks retain their coarse texture and fibrous inclusions, visible evidence of their origin.
Limits and Questions
The project raises practical questions. Durability in tropical climates is a concern; organic binders and high humidity can accelerate degradation. The steel armature provides structural support, but the bricks themselves are vulnerable to erosion, insect activity, and mold. Maintenance protocols will determine whether Goya endures as a permanent landmark or functions as a temporary installation, a demonstration rather than a prototype.
There is also the question of scalability. Elephant dung is plentiful in certain contexts but not universally available. The material's viability depends on proximity to elephant populations, which are themselves under threat. If the method were to be adopted more widely, it would require stable, ethical supply chains, a challenge in regions where elephants are endangered or their habitats fragmented.
Finally, there is the symbolic dimension. Does the use of elephant waste honor the animal, or does it instrumentalize it further? Premthada's intent appears to be the former, framing the material as a collaborative output, evidence of a shared ecosystem. But intent does not always align with reception. How the structure is interpreted will depend on who encounters it and under what circumstances.
Circularity, Reimagined
At World Archi Design, we have tracked a growing interest in closed-loop material systems, from mycelium panels to hempcrete to recycled textile composites. Goya contributes to this discourse by proposing that waste streams need not be industrial. Biological byproducts, managed thoughtfully, can enter the architectural supply chain with minimal processing and low environmental cost.
The tower does not solve Thailand's housing crisis or provide a replicable model for mass construction. What it does offer is a provocation: a reminder that material innovation need not always look forward. Sometimes it means looking around, at what already exists, at what has always been there, waiting to be reconsidered.
